Troubleshooting Common Askoll Pump Issues (UNI012/S)

Facing issues with your Askoll UNI012/S pump? Frustrating problems can pop up unexpectedly. Let's walk through some common culprits and how to resolve them.

First, check the power supply. Ensure the pump is plugged in securely and the outlet is functioning properly. Next, inspect the entry hose for any blockages. A clogged hose can restrict water flow and cause your pump to struggle. If the problem persists, investigate the impeller. This crucial part rotates to push water through the system. Check for damage that might impede its function.

Finally, remember to refer to your pump's user manual for specific troubleshooting tips and instructions tailored to your model.
